WebAug 16, 2024 · How long should a graveside service last? It may include readings, prayers, or songs and may last no longer than 20 to 30 minutes. How long will the graveside service be if it’s the only ceremony? It could be short or it could last up to an hour. You may want to incorporate readings, prayers, and songs, a short sermon, and more. WebApr 18, 2024 · Typically the graveside service is not very long. It normally consists of the officiant beginning the service with reciting prayers or reading a passage. Then a eulogy may be given and finally the body will be lowered into the ground. WebMay 2, 2024 · The only difference between this and a funeral service is that the body will be placed within the ground. Some families choose to host both a funeral and graveside service, while others limit the occasion to just one. There’s no right or wrong way to have an interment as long as they follow the guidelines of the cemetery. WebGraveside Funeral Service. Graveside funeral services are also called Direct Burial. Commonly depicted in movies, these are funeral services in which there is not a formal viewing or ceremony except for those performed directly at the gravesite.
